Abstract: The disclosure is related to a touch display device including a display panel. By dividing an active area of the display panel into a plurality of sub-areas, and driving a touch electrode disposed on each of the plurality of sub-areas separately, a load of the touch electrodes is reduced depending on a size of the display panel and a performance of a touch sensing can be improved.

Abstract: A touch display device is disclosed. By arranging a part of a touch routing line for a driving of a touch electrode on an active area and electrically connecting the touch routing line to an auxiliary routing pattern that overlaps the touch routing line, an area where the touch routing line is disposed and a load of the touch routing line can be reduced.

Abstract: A touch display device is disclosed. Since a touch electrode line included in the display device is divided into two or more touch electrode line parts connected to different touch routing lines, an entire load of the touch electrode line and the touch routing line can be reduced. As a portion of the touch routing line is disposed on an active area and touch routing lines connected to different touch electrode line parts are connected to each other between the active area and a touch driving circuit, an entire load can be reduced without an increase of a non-active area and an increase of a channel due to the touch routing lines, and a performance of a touch sensing can be improved.

Abstract: The present disclosure relates to a touch display device and a touch sensing method, and more specifically, to a touch display device and a touch sensing method that provides a single-layered touch sensor structure by a touch electrode connecting line that electrically connects touch electrodes arranged in one direction and is arranged to bypass and surround touch electrodes arranged in another direction, thereby enabling a simple manufacturing process, a high manufacturing yield, and a low manufacturing cost.

Abstract: A touch display device is disclosed. The touch display device includes a touch electrode and a touch routing line that are disposed on an area that is different from an area where a spacer is disposed. Thus, a touch sensing function can be provided in the touch display device while reducing an influence that a touch sensor structure affects a viewing angle of an image.

Abstract: A display device includes a substrate including a display area and a pad area; a thin film transistor in the display area; a light emitting film layer on the thin film transistor; an encapsulation layer on the light emitting film layer; a touch buffer layer on the encapsulation layer; a bridge, first touch electrodes and second touch electrodes disposed on the touch buffer layer; a touch insulating film disposed between the bridge and the first touch electrodes and the second touch electrodes; a touch pad in the pad area; a touch sensing line connected to the first touch electrodes; and a touch driving line connected to the second touch electrodes, wherein at least one of the touch sensing line and the touch driving line is provided on a side surface of the encapsulation layer.

Abstract: A touch display device is disclosed. By making at least one of a thickness or an angle of inclination of an insulating layer disposed on an area where a touch routing line is disposed on a non-active area of a display panel and an area that lacks the touch routing line to be different from each other, a short circuit between touch routing lines due to a defect in a process arranging the touch routing lines can be reduced.

Abstract: Embodiments of the present disclosure are related to a touch display device. As a shape of a touch electrode adjacent to a boundary of an active area is implemented according to an arrangement structure of a light-emitting area of a subpixel, a touch sensing structure can be disposed to be suitable to an image display structure of a display panel.

Abstract: Embodiments of the present disclosure are related to a touch display device, as a touch insulating film positioned under a touch electrode has a step difference and the touch electrode is disposed along a surface of the touch insulating film having the step difference. Thus, an area of the touch electrode disposed on an identical region increases and touch sensitivity can be improved. Furthermore, since the touch electrode is positioned lower toward from a central portion to an outer portion, a structure of the touch electrode being capable of improving touch sensitivity can be implemented without reducing a viewing angle of a light emitted from a light-emitting element positioned under the touch electrode.
